การแยกข้อมูลอัตโนมัติ

แยกข้อมูลอัตโนมัติด้วย Aspose.Cells สำหรับ Java

การแยกข้อมูลจากไฟล์ Excel เป็นงานทั่วไปในแอปพลิเคชันทางธุรกิจต่างๆ การทำให้กระบวนการนี้เป็นอัตโนมัติสามารถประหยัดเวลาและปรับปรุงความแม่นยำได้ ในบทช่วยสอนนี้ เราจะสำรวจวิธีการแยกข้อมูลโดยอัตโนมัติโดยใช้ Aspose.Cells for Java ซึ่งเป็น Java API ที่มีประสิทธิภาพสำหรับการทำงานกับไฟล์ Excel

เหตุใดจึงต้องแยกข้อมูลอัตโนมัติ

การดึงข้อมูลอัตโนมัติมีข้อดีหลายประการ:

  1. ประสิทธิภาพ: ขจัดการแยกข้อมูลด้วยตนเอง ประหยัดเวลาและความพยายาม
  2. ความแม่นยำ: ลดความเสี่ยงของข้อผิดพลาดในการดึงข้อมูล
  3. ความสอดคล้อง: รักษาการจัดรูปแบบข้อมูลที่เหมือนกันในการแยกข้อมูล
  4. ความสามารถในการปรับขนาด: จัดการข้อมูลปริมาณมากได้อย่างง่ายดาย

เริ่มต้นใช้งาน

1. การจัดสภาพแวดล้อม

ขั้นแรก ตรวจสอบให้แน่ใจว่าคุณได้ติดตั้ง Aspose.Cells สำหรับ Java แล้ว คุณสามารถดาวน์โหลดได้จากที่นี่.

2. การเริ่มต้น Aspose.Cells

มาสร้างแอปพลิเคชัน Java และเริ่มต้น Aspose.Cells:

import com.aspose.cells.Workbook;

public class DataExtraction {
    public static void main(String[] args) {
        // เริ่มต้น Aspose.Cells
        Workbook workbook = new Workbook();
    }
}

3. กำลังโหลดข้อมูล Excel

หากต้องการแยกข้อมูล คุณต้องโหลดไฟล์ Excel ต่อไปนี้คือวิธีที่คุณสามารถทำได้:

// โหลดไฟล์ Excel
workbook.open("sample.xlsx");

// เข้าถึงแผ่นงาน
Worksheet worksheet = workbook.getWorksheets().get(0);

การแยกข้อมูลอัตโนมัติ

4. การแยกข้อมูลเฉพาะ

คุณสามารถแยกข้อมูลเฉพาะจากเซลล์ Excel ได้โดยใช้ Aspose.Cells ตัวอย่างเช่น ลองแยกค่าของเซลล์:

// แยกข้อมูลจากเซลล์ A1
String data = worksheet.getCells().get("A1").getStringValue();
System.out.println("Data from A1: " + data);

5. การสกัดข้อมูลจำนวนมาก

หากต้องการดึงข้อมูลจากช่วงของเซลล์ ให้ใช้รหัสต่อไปนี้:

// กำหนดช่วง (เช่น A1:B10)
CellArea cellArea = new CellArea();
cellArea.StartRow = 0;
cellArea.StartColumn = 0;
cellArea.EndRow = 9;
cellArea.EndColumn = 1;

// แยกข้อมูลจากช่วงที่กำหนด
String[][] extractedData = worksheet.getCells().exportArray(cellArea);

บทสรุป

การดึงข้อมูลอัตโนมัติด้วย Aspose.Cells สำหรับ Java ช่วยให้กระบวนการดึงข้อมูลจากไฟล์ Excel ง่ายขึ้น ด้วยตัวอย่างซอร์สโค้ดที่ให้มา คุณสามารถปรับใช้การแยกข้อมูลในแอปพลิเคชัน Java ของคุณได้อย่างง่ายดาย

คำถามที่พบบ่อย

1. ฉันสามารถแยกข้อมูลจากไฟล์ Excel ที่มีการป้องกันด้วยรหัสผ่านได้หรือไม่

ใช่ Aspose.Cells สำหรับ Java รองรับการแยกข้อมูลจากไฟล์ที่มีการป้องกันด้วยรหัสผ่าน

2. มีการจำกัดขนาดของไฟล์ Excel ที่สามารถประมวลผลได้หรือไม่?

Aspose.Cells สามารถจัดการไฟล์ Excel ขนาดใหญ่ได้อย่างมีประสิทธิภาพ

3. ฉันจะดึงข้อมูลจากแผ่นงานหลายแผ่นในไฟล์ Excel ได้อย่างไร

คุณสามารถวนซ้ำเวิร์กชีตและดึงข้อมูลจากแต่ละรายการได้โดยใช้ Aspose.Cells

4. มีข้อกำหนดสิทธิ์การใช้งานสำหรับ Aspose.Cells สำหรับ Java หรือไม่

ใช่ คุณจะต้องมีใบอนุญาตที่ถูกต้องเพื่อใช้ Aspose.Cells สำหรับ Java ในโปรเจ็กต์ของคุณ

5. ฉันจะหาแหล่งข้อมูลเพิ่มเติมและเอกสารประกอบสำหรับ Aspose.Cells for Java ได้ที่ไหน

สำรวจเอกสารประกอบ API ได้ที่[https://reference.aspose.com/cells/java/](https://reference.aspose.com/cells/java/) สำหรับข้อมูลเชิงลึกและตัวอย่าง

เริ่มงานแยกข้อมูลของคุณโดยอัตโนมัติวันนี้ด้วย Aspose.Cells สำหรับ Java และปรับปรุงกระบวนการดึงข้อมูลของคุณ